Mr. Charlie Nunn is Group Managing Director, Chief Executive Officer, Retail Banking and Wealth Management of the company. Charlie joined HSBC in 2011 and became a Group Managing Director and CEO, Retail Banking and Wealth Management in January 2018. Charlie was previously Head of Group Retail Banking and Wealth Management, leading the teams supporting HSBCs Retail and Wealth businesses globally. Prior to this, he was Group Head of Wealth Management and before that Global Chief Operating Officer for Retail Banking and Wealth Management. Charlie has extensive financial services experience and was formerly a Partner at Accenture and a Senior Partner at McKinsey Co. since 2018.

HSBC Holdings PLC Leadership Team
Elected by the shareholders, the HSBC Holdings' board of directors comprises two types of representatives: HSBC Holdings inside directors who are chosen from within the company, and outside directors, selected externally and held independent of HSBC. The board's role is to monitor HSBC Holdings' management team and ensure that shareholders' interests are well served. HSBC Holdings' inside directors are responsible for reviewing and approving budgets prepared by upper management to implement core corporate initiatives and projects. On the other hand, HSBC Holdings' outside directors are responsible for providing unbiased perspectives on the board's policies.
